#4cd4d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cd4d1 is composed of 29.8% red, 83.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 178.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#4cd4d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00a9a3.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4cd4d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cd4d1 has RGB values of R:76, G:212,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5035217.

Shades and Tints of #4cd4d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cd4d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889898 is the less saturated color, while #21fffa is the most saturated one.
